- 用途
- 作为咖啡Coffea Arabica的成分之一,具有抗炎、抗血管生成和抗癌活性;通过活化AMPK抑制脂肪生成并增加葡萄糖摄取,诱导细胞凋亡;对致癌物激活的肝细胞色素P450酶(CYP450)和硫转移酶(SULT)有抑制趋向,可能减弱致癌物质的激活,起到化学防癌作用;复杂混合物与其纯化单体成分在活性方面表现出明显不同作用;体外研究显示其可降低TGF-β诱导的CTGF蛋白表达、磷酸化Smad2/3表达(AML12细胞),降低TGF-β刺激的磷酸化ERK和JNK表达(原代肝细胞),增加AMPK及其下游靶点ACC的磷酸化,减少PPARγ、C/EBPα、FABP4和FASN的表达
